Manufacturer Recommendations: Every vehicle manufacturer provides guidelines regarding oil change intervals based on factors such as engine type, mileage, and driving conditions. Consult your vehicle's owner manual or the manufacturer's website to determine the recommended oil change frequency. Adhering to these recommendations is a crucial starting point for maintaining your vehicle's warranty and ensuring peak performance. Mileage-Based Intervals: A common practice is to change the engine oil and filter every 3,000 to 5,000 miles, but this can vary depending on the type of oil used and driving conditions. Conventional motor oil typically requires more frequent changes compared to synthetic oils. However, advancements in synthetic oils have extended oil change intervals, typically ranging from 7,500 to 10,000 miles. Again, it's essential to refer to the manufacturer's recommendations for your specific vehicle. Driving Conditions: Your driving habits and the conditions you encounter play a significant role in determining oil change frequency. If you regularly drive in severe conditions such as extreme temperatures, dusty environments, stop-and-go traffic, or frequently tow heavy loads, you may need to change your oil and filter more frequently. These demanding conditions can cause increased wear and tear on the engine, necessitating more frequent maintenance. Oil Quality: Regularly monitoring the quality of your engine oil is essential for optimal vehicle maintenance. Checking the oil's color, consistency, and level using the dipstick can provide insights into its condition. If the oil appears excessively dark, gritty, or has a burnt smell, it's time to change it, regardless of the mileage. Regular oil analysis can also be beneficial in assessing the oil's condition and determining the right time for a change. Warning Signs: Certain warning signs may indicate the need for an immediate oil change. These signs include engine noise, decreased fuel efficiency, engine overheating, or the illumination of the oil pressure warning light on the dashboard. If you experience any of these symptoms, it's crucial to address them promptly to prevent potential engine damage. Regular Filter Replacement: In addition to changing the engine oil, it's equally important to replace the oil filter regularly. The oil filter helps remove contaminants and particles that can harm the engine. The recommended filter change interval typically coincides with the engine oil change interval. Neglecting filter replacement can lead to reduced oil flow, decreased lubrication efficiency, and increased wear on engine components. Understanding Engine Oil Viscosity: Engine oil viscosity refers to the oil's thickness or resistance to flow at different temperatures. It is denoted by a combination of numbers such as 5W-30 or 10W-40, where the first number indicates the oil's viscosity during cold starts (W for winter) and the second number represents its viscosity at operating temperature. A higher number denotes a thicker oil. The Importance of Choosing the Right Viscosity: Engine oil viscosity plays a crucial role in lubricating engine components, reducing friction, and dissipating heat. Using the wrong viscosity can lead to inadequate lubrication, poor engine performance, increased fuel consumption, and potential damage to critical engine parts. Therefore, it's vital to understand your vehicle manufacturer's recommendations and environmental factors that may influence your viscosity choice. Factors Influencing Viscosity Selection: a. Manufacturer Recommendations: Always consult your vehicle owner's manual to determine the recommended oil viscosity. Manufacturers perform extensive testing to determine the optimal oil viscosity for their engines, ensuring maximum performance and longevity. b. Climate and Temperature: Different viscosity grades perform differently in varying temperatures. Lower viscosity oils, such as 0W-20 or 5W-30, offer better flow during cold starts, providing faster lubrication to engine components. In contrast, higher viscosity oils, like 10W-40 or 20W-50, maintain better film strength and stability at high operating temperatures. c. Driving Conditions and Vehicle Age: Intense driving conditions, such as towing heavy loads or frequent stop-and-go traffic, may require higher viscosity oils to withstand increased stress. Older vehicles with higher mileage may benefit from slightly thicker oils to compensate for potential wear and reduced tolerances. Benefits of Synthetic Engine Oils: Synthetic engine oils offer numerous advantages over conventional mineral oils, including better viscosity stability across temperature ranges, improved engine protection, enhanced fuel economy, and extended drain intervals. Consider using synthetic oils that meet the specifications recommended by your vehicle manufacturer. The Purpose of an Oil Filter: The oil filter plays a crucial role in the lubrication system of your vehicle. It is responsible for removing impurities, such as dirt, debris, and contaminants, from the oil before it circulates through the engine. By capturing these harmful particles, the oil filter prevents them from circulating and potentially causing damage to engine components. Implications of Not Changing the Oil Filter: When you change the oil without replacing the oil filter, several consequences can occur: a. Reduced Oil Flow: Over time, the oil filter becomes clogged with trapped particles, restricting the flow of oil through the engine. This reduced oil flow hinders the lubrication process, leading to increased friction and wear on engine parts. b. Poor Engine Performance: The accumulation of contaminants in the oil can negatively impact the engine's performance. The engine may experience reduced power, decreased fuel efficiency, and increased emissions. Additionally, the engine may produce unusual sounds or vibrations, indicating potential damage. c. Increased Engine Wear and Tear: Without a properly functioning oil filter, dirt and debris continue to circulate in the oil, increasing the risk of abrasive particles reaching vital engine components. Over time, this can lead to accelerated wear and tear, potentially resulting in costly repairs or even engine failure. d. Compromised Oil Quality: As the oil filter becomes overwhelmed with contaminants, it loses its effectiveness, allowing impurities to remain in the oil. Contaminated oil cannot provide adequate lubrication, causing further damage to engine parts and reducing the oil's overall lifespan. Conventional Oil: Conventional oil, also known as mineral oil, has been the standard choice for decades. It is derived from crude oil and goes through a refining process to remove impurities. While conventional oil provides adequate lubrication, it has its limitations. It tends to break down faster under high temperatures and extreme conditions, requiring more frequent oil changes. Synthetic Blend Oil: Synthetic blend oil combines conventional oil with synthetic base oils. This blend offers some advantages of synthetic oil at a more affordable price point. Synthetic blend oil provides better protection against high temperatures and engine stress compared to conventional oil. It also offers improved fuel efficiency and longer-lasting performance. This option is ideal for drivers who engage in moderate towing or driving in challenging conditions. Full Synthetic Oil: Full synthetic oil is engineered to provide superior performance and protection for modern engines. It is formulated using advanced chemical compounds and synthetic base oils. Full synthetic oil offers excellent lubrication even under extreme temperatures and prolonged use. It flows better at low temperatures, ensuring a smoother start-up and reduced engine wear. Its consistent molecular structure also helps prevent the formation of sludge and deposits, promoting engine cleanliness and longevity. Choosing the Right Oil for Your Vehicle: To determine the best oil option for your vehicle, consider the following factors: Driving Conditions: If you frequently drive in extreme temperatures, tow heavy loads, or participate in high-performance driving, full synthetic oil is recommended for its superior heat resistance and performance. Vehicle Age and Mileage: Older vehicles with higher mileage may benefit from full synthetic oil to minimize engine wear and enhance overall performance. Manufacturer Recommendations: Consult your vehicle's owner's manual for the manufacturer's recommended oil type. Some newer vehicles require full synthetic oil for optimal performance and warranty compliance. Budget: Synthetic blend oil offers a cost-effective compromise between conventional and full synthetic oil, providing improved performance without breaking the bank. Insufficient Oil Level: One of the most common reasons for the low oil pressure light to come on is an insufficient oil level. If your vehicle has been experiencing oil leaks or hasn't had regular oil changes, the oil level may drop below the recommended range. Inadequate oil supply leads to reduced oil pressure, triggering the warning light. Regularly check your oil level and address any leaks promptly. Oil Pump Failure: The oil pump plays a vital role in maintaining proper oil pressure throughout the engine. If the pump fails or malfunctions, it can disrupt the oil flow, causing the low oil pressure light to activate. Reasons for oil pump failure may include worn-out gears, damaged seals, or clogged filters. Consult a professional mechanic to diagnose and replace the faulty oil pump. Clogged Oil Filter: Over time, the oil filter can become clogged with debris, sludge, or contaminants, hindering the oil flow. A clogged oil filter restricts the passage of oil and results in reduced oil pressure. Regular oil filter replacements during routine maintenance can help prevent this issue. Consult your vehicle's manual for the recommended oil filter replacement interval. Worn-out Engine Bearings: Engine bearings are responsible for reducing friction between moving parts. Over time, these bearings can wear out, leading to increased clearance between the engine components. As a result, oil pressure drops, triggering the low oil pressure light. If you notice excessive engine noise or poor performance, have a professional inspect the engine bearings and replace them if necessary. Thin or Contaminated Oil: Using the wrong viscosity of oil or contaminated oil can affect its ability to maintain proper lubrication and oil pressure. Check your vehicle's manual to ensure you're using the recommended oil viscosity. Additionally, consider performing regular oil changes and using high-quality oil to prevent contamination. Dirty or contaminated oil can lead to engine damage and a lit low oil pressure light. Faulty Oil Pressure Sensor: Sometimes, the low oil pressure light can be triggered by a faulty oil pressure sensor. This sensor is responsible for detecting the oil pressure and signaling the warning light. If the sensor malfunctions or gives false readings, it may illuminate the low oil pressure light even when the pressure is within the normal range. Have a professional mechanic diagnose and replace the faulty sensor if needed.
